Your Commitment to Wearing the Aligners

Invisalign® works best when the aligners are worn consistently—about 20 to 22 hours each day. They should only come out for eating, drinking anything other than water, and brushing. Imagine how easy it would be to forget to reinsert it—by doing so you slow down—or stall—progress, which is very serious.

The Condition of Your Teeth and Gums

Before treatment begins, your orthodontist in Gurnee, IL will check for any issues like cavities, gum disease, or misalignment that’s too severe for Invisalign® alone. Clear aligners are great for mild to moderate adjustments, but more complex cases might need braces or a combination of treatments. A healthy mouth creates the foundation for a successful outcome.

Lifestyle and Daily Habits

Because you remove aligners to eat, frequent snacking or sipping coffee throughout the day can make things tricky. You’ll need to brush after every meal before putting the trays back in. For people on the go, that might mean carrying a travel toothbrush or adjusting meal routines. The payoff, though, is freedom from wires and the ability to enjoy your favorite foods without restrictions.

What Are Invisalign® Attachments?

If you’ve decided to get Invisalign®, you probably have loads of questions before you get started, right? One of the most common questions about getting Invisalign® clear dental aligners is whether they have brackets. So, let’s talk about that for a moment.

Do Invisalign® Dental Aligners Have Brackets?

Do Invisalign® dental aligners in Gurnee, IL, have brackets like conventional braces do? The answer is sort of. Here’s what that means.

Invisalign® dental aligners don’t have brackets to hold them in place like conventional metal braces. However, they do have attachments, which aren’t anything like the brackets used with metal braces.

What are Invisalign® Attachments?

Invisalign® attachments are small, almost invisible, custom-made pieces of resin that are strategically placed on your teeth. Attachments are used to help the aligners move your teeth into position in a more controlled and precise manner. Using attachments with your Invisalign® dental aligners helps move your teeth more quickly, resulting in a shorter treatment time.

How Are Invisalign® Attachments Placed?

Attachments come in a variety of shapes and sizes. Each shape is designated for a different purpose (intrusions, extrusions, or rotations). Your orthodontist will bond the resin attachments to the middle of specific teeth. They will then use a bonding agent and a special light to help them adhere to your teeth.

Do Attachments Have to be Used with an Invisalign® Treatment?

No, attachments don’t have to be used. However, not opting for attachments could make some dental corrections impossible or could result in the treatment taking longer.

 How to Care for Your Invisalign® Braces

Your Invisalign® braces will do a great job of correcting gaps, misaligned or crowded teeth, underbites, overbites, open bites, and crossbites if you care for them correctly. Dr. Goshgarian, your orthodontist in Lake Forest and Gurnee will create your personalized Invisalign® tray to work its magic, and then it’s up to you to wear and care for your braces. Follow these best practices and get the smile you deserve:

1. Clean Your Invisalign® Aligners When You Brush Your Teeth

If you need to wear your Invisalign® all day, clean them in the morning and evening when you brush your teeth. If you only wear them overnight, clean them when you take them out in the morning before you put them back into their case.

2. Add a Lunchtime Rinse

After lunch, find a place to rinse your Invisalign® off with clean, lukewarm water to remove food particles.

3. How to Clean Your Invisalign® Braces

You will need: clean hands, lukewarm water, a recommended clear, unscented antibacterial soap, and a soft-bristled toothbrush. You should use a separate toothbrush for your aligners—not the same one you use on your teeth.

  • Gently brush all surfaces of the aligners with a tiny bit of the recommended cleaner and rinse them thoroughly with lukewarm water.
  • Brush your teeth before putting the aligners back on.

4. Deep Clean Your Aligners Once Weekly

Your Lake Forest orthodontist recommends disinfecting your Invisalign® trays once a week using Invisalign® cleaning crystals. Use the package directions and soak your aligners in the solution for about 20-30 minutes. Rinse them off with lukewarm water and reapply, or store them in their case.

5. Encase When Not In Use

If you only wear your aligners at night, stow them safely in their case after you clean them in the morning so they’ll stay clean.

How Invisalign® Works

At Goshgarian Orthodontics, we leverage the latest technologies in orthodontics in order to provide our new and existing patients with the highest quality service. One of the modern treatments available for gaps between teeth, and bite and alignment issues is Invisalign®. Invisalign® treatment consists of a series of clear, removable aligners that gradually move teeth back into correct position. Unlike traditional braces, Invisalign® offers wearers a lot more convenience and comfort, while delivering similar results.

Are You a Candidate For Invisalign®?

Invisalign® may be appropriate for mild to moderate alignment issues. When you visit your orthodontist in Lake Forest, IL, you’ll be assessed to determine the best course of treatment for your individual needs. If Invisalign® is presented as an option, you may have questions about how it works.

How Invisalign® Works

Teeth naturally shift according to the bone surrounding them. Invisalign® takes advantage of this biological process. When pressure is applied to a tooth, the bone on one side of the root resorbs, while new bone forms on the other side. The aligners that are the core of Invisalign® treatment are specially designed to exert force on certain teeth in order to gently guide them into proper alignment over a period of time.

What to Expect With Invisalign®

Patients need to wear the Invisalign® aligners at least 21 hours in each 24-hour period. Conveniently, the aligner can be removed for eating, oral hygiene or for special occasions. Checkups about once every two weeks will be needed so that the orthodontist can monitor the progress and ensure that everything is going according to plan.

What Are the Limitations of Invisalign?

Invisalign has revolutionized orthodontic treatment by offering a discreet and convenient alternative to traditional braces. While this orthodontic treatment in Lake Forest, IL has become immensely popular for its aesthetic appeal and flexibility, it’s important for patients to be aware of the limitations associated with Invisalign.

Invisalign is Not For Serious Alignment Issues

For serious alignment issues, traditional braces are still the gold standard. Whether you choose the standard metal braces with brackets on the outside of the teeth or the more discreet variation called lingual braces attached to the inside is a discussion for you and your orthodontist. However, Invisalign is likely not an option for severe overbites and underbites.

Maturity is Essential

Invisalign is very attractive to people in the public eye, and teens are prone to be more self-conscious. These are just some of the demographics who are drawn to Invisalign as an orthodontic treatment. However, maturity is essential for the success of Invisalign treatment. Unlike traditional braces that are fixed in place, Invisalign aligners are removable. This means that patients must commit to wearing the aligners for at least 22 hours a day for the treatment to be effective. Non-compliance or inconsistent use can lead to prolonged treatment times or suboptimal results.

Bad Habits Will Influence Results

Another limitation of Invisalign is that bad habits can heavily hinder results. Habits like bruxism, teeth clenching, ice chewing, and more can put excessive pressure on the aligners and affect their durability and performance. In such cases, the orthodontist may recommend alternative solutions to ensure the stability and effectiveness of the treatment.

Will I Need Braces, or Can I Get Invisalign?

When you and your Gurnee, IL, orthodontistare discussing treatment options to straighten your teeth or correct your bite, you might wonder whether traditional braces or Invisalign is the right choice for you. Both methods are designed to align teeth over time, but they do so in different ways and are suited to different types of orthodontic issues. Here’s a brief overview to help you understand which option might suit your situation better.

Traditional Braces

Braces consist of metal brackets that are applied to your teeth and connected by wires. Braces are a robust solution that can handle the most severe crowding, spacing, alignment problems, and complex bite issues such as overbites, underbites, and crossbites.

Invisalign

Invisalign is a brand of clear aligners, which are nearly invisible, removable trays made of plastic. Invisalign is popular among adults and teenagers who are looking for a less noticeable form of orthodontic treatment. However, Invisalign is best suited for mild to moderate dental misalignments, including crowding, spacing, and bite problems.

Deciding Factors

Ultimately, your orthodontist will make the final decision as to what the best course of treatment for your alignment issues is. The dentist will take into account several factors, including:

Severity of Orthodontic Issues

Traditional braces might be recommended if you have severe crowding, spacing, or complex bite issues due to their robustness and ability to handle intricate adjustments. While effective for a wide range of corrections, Invisalign might not be suitable for more complex orthodontic needs.

Aesthetics

If the visibility of braces is a big concern for you, your dentist might agree to Invisalign, particularly if you are of school age or work in a professional capacity where aesthetics matter a great deal.

Lifestyle

Invisalign requires discipline to wear the aligners for the recommended 22 hours daily. If you think you might forget to wear them or prefer not to be responsible for removing and inserting the aligners throughout the day, traditional braces might be a better fit.
